Output 281077930050d67f181bc42453abe332a9f7cb4f0ccec81c9cd57e407a42ebba:4

value
5071008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3357448da08b16b970fbeca5747c5f77dfb5b3a OP_EQUAL
address
3J2auwsXiJhCigMkQcyNU9jbeaWAvtF1cA
transaction
281077930050d67f181bc42453abe332a9f7cb4f0ccec81c9cd57e407a42ebba
spent
true